35 Ringles Cross, Uckfield, East Sussex, England, TN22 1HG
The Dell, 35 Ringles Cross, Uckfield, East Sussex, England, TN22 1HG
Popular Companies
Latest Companies
Copyright © 2024. All rights reserved.